AECOM’s Water Business Line is looking for a Senior Manager of Program Advisory to lead our Water group in Oakland, California. This esteemed position will oversee the planning, management, and implementation of coastal, riverine, and urban projects aimed at enhancing long-term system resilience for a broad spectrum of public and private clientele. Our resilience initiatives focus on innovative strategies to bolster performance and mitigate hazards within watershed and coastal systems, integrating traditional and nature-based solutions while considering climate, social, and ecological impacts.
The ideal candidate will possess extensive technical knowledge in coastal engineering, water resource management, climate resilience, and sustainable infrastructure. A proven track record of managing intricate, multidisciplinary projects from conception through to construction is essential. This role demands exceptional client relationship management skills and the ability to collaborate effectively across various internal service lines to deliver cohesive solutions. The Senior Manager will engage closely with federal, state, and local agencies, as well as private sector partners, to navigate regulatory frameworks and explore funding opportunities. Alongside technical leadership, this position includes significant business development responsibilities, such as nurturing existing client relationships, identifying new prospects, and contributing to the growth of our water practice in California and beyond. The ideal candidate will be a collaborative leader thriving in a dynamic consulting environment focused on delivering resilient, sustainable infrastructure solutions.
Key Responsibilities:
- Manage a team of planners, scientists, and engineers on regional planning projects addressing sea level rise, climate change, and resilient community development.
- Act as Project Manager for coastal, watershed, and water infrastructure initiatives, encompassing facility master plans, sustainability management plans, and climate vulnerability assessments.
- Provide technical oversight and ensure quality control on engineering reports, assessments, studies, and planning documents.
- Develop and implement climate resilience strategies for major infrastructure projects across public and private sectors.
- Identify and advocate for sustainable, nature-based engineering solutions in water, transportation, and coastal infrastructure projects.
- Translate complex climate science into actionable insights for clients, stakeholders, and government partners.
- Foster and manage relationships with clients, regulatory bodies, and community stakeholders throughout project lifecycles to promote climate and resilience initiatives.
